Brendan O'Kelly (10 June 1928 – 24 October 2017) was a soccer player who played in the 1940s in the League of Ireland.
[1] O'Kelly was an attacking player on the amateur Bohemians of the 1940s.
[2] O'Kelly represented Ireland at the 1948 Olympic Games scoring Ireland's goal.
[3] Off the field, Brendan was a Harvard University graduate and was appointed chairman of Bord Iascaigh Mhara in 1963.
